Company Overview

overview logo History and Background

AMN Healthcare Services Inc. was founded in 1985. Initially focused on travel nursing, it expanded to offer a broader range of healthcare staffing and workforce solutions through organic growth and acquisitions. The company has grown to become a leading provider of healthcare workforce solutions.

business area logo Core Business Areas

  • Nurse and Allied Solutions: Provides travel nurse staffing, allied healthcare staffing, and rapid response staffing services.
  • Physician and Leadership Solutions: Offers physician staffing, interim leadership staffing, and executive search services.
  • Technology and Workforce Solutions: Provides workforce management technologies and consulting services.

Top Products and Market Share

overview logo Key Offerings

  • Travel Nurse Staffing: AMN Healthcare's largest segment, providing temporary nurse staffing solutions to healthcare facilities nationwide. Competitors include Cross Country Healthcare and Aya Healthcare. Specific revenue figures and market share are complex and variable; however, AMN is a leading player in the travel nursing industry estimated at above 20% market share.
  • Allied Healthcare Staffing: Provides temporary staffing solutions for allied health professionals like therapists and medical technicians. Competitors include Cross Country Healthcare and Maxim Healthcare Services. Market share data is complex, but AMN holds a significant position in this market as well.
  • Physician Staffing (Locum Tenens): Offers temporary physician staffing services to healthcare facilities. Competitors include CHG Healthcare Services and Weatherby Healthcare. AMN has a notable presence in this segment.

Major Acquisitions

Stratus Video

  • Year: 2020
  • Acquisition Price (USD millions): 475
  • Strategic Rationale: Enhanced telehealth capabilities and expanded language services for healthcare providers.

AMN Healthcare Services, Inc. provides technology-enabled healthcare workforce solutions and staffing services to acute and sub-acute care hospitals, and other healthcare facilities in the United States. It operates through three segments: Nurse and Allied Solutions, Physician and Leadership Solutions, and Technology and Workforce Solutions. The Nurse and Allied Solutions segment offers travel nurse staffing, labor disruption staffing, local staffing, international nurse permanent placement, allied staffing, crisis nurse staffing for critical staffing and rapid response nursing, and allied health professionals, such as skilled nursing facilities, rehabilitation clinics, schools, and pharmacies. This segment also provides allied health professionals, such as physical therapists, respiratory therapists, occupational therapists, medical and radiology technologists, lab technicians, speech pathologists, rehabilitation assistants, and pharmacists; and solutions for schools, including teletherapy platform, Televate, and qualified school speech-language pathologists, psychologists, nurses, social workers, and other care providers. The Physician and Leadership Solutions segment offers locum tenens staffing, healthcare interim leadership staffing, executive search, and physician permanent placement solutions. The Technology and Workforce Solutions segment offers language services, vendor management systems, workforce optimization, and outsourced solutions. The company offers its services under the brands, including AMN Healthcare, Nursefinders, O'Grady Peyton International, Connetics, Medical Search International, DRW Healthcare Staffing, and B.E. Smith. AMN Healthcare Services, Inc. was founded in 1985 and is based in Dallas, Texas.
